What Are Surety Contract Bonds?



Surety Contract bonds are a sort of monetary guarantee that offers assurance to job proprietors that contractors will meet their legal obligations. These bonds function as a kind of security for the project proprietor by guaranteeing that the specialist will certainly complete the project as agreed upon, or compensate for any kind of financial loss incurred.

The Advantages and Relevance of Surety Contract Bonds



Understanding the benefits and importance of Surety Contract bonds is critical for all events involved in a construction project.



Surety Contract bonds provide financial protection and satisfaction for task proprietors, service providers, and subcontractors. For job owners, these bonds ensure that the specialist will fulfill their obligations and complete the project as set. This shields the proprietor from monetary loss in case of service provider default or non-performance.

Contractors gain from Surety Contract bonds as well, as they supply credibility and demonstrate their capability to accomplish legal commitments. Subcontractors likewise profit, as they're ensured of settlement for their work, even if the professional stops working to pay them.

Additionally, Surety Contract bonds advertise reasonable competitors by making sure that contractors are economically efficient in taking on the project. In general, these bonds mitigate dangers, boost task success, and foster trust fund and confidence among all celebrations included.
